A forcola (plural forcole) is the rowlock or oarpost used in
traditional Venetian boats, the most well-known type of boat being the
gondola. Forcole are unlike any other type of rowlock because of the
unique rowing position of the oarsman: he stands facing forward and, in
craft like the gondola, propels and manouevres the boat with a single oar.
|
|
The various manoeuvres require different postitions of
the oar, so the forcola must provide a number of leverage points. This
accounts for its sinuous, organic shape.
